Course details
Campaign Objective: Understanding the different types of campaign objectives, such as Conversions, Website Traffic, Lead Generation, and Brand Awareness, is crucial for creating effective LinkedIn ad campaigns. •
Target Audience: Identifying the right target audience, including job title, industry, company size, and location, is vital for ensuring that your ads reach the most relevant professionals. •
Ad Creative: Creating eye-catching ad creative, including images, videos, and headlines, that resonate with your target audience and align with your campaign objective is essential. •
Budget Allocation: Allocating your budget effectively, including setting a daily budget, bidding strategy, and ad group budget, is critical for maximizing ROI and achieving your campaign objective. •
Ad Extensions: Utilizing ad extensions, such as callouts, site links, and call extensions, can enhance the user experience, increase click-through rates, and drive more conversions. •
LinkedIn Ads Formats: Understanding the different LinkedIn ads formats, such as sponsored content, sponsored InMail, and display ads, can help you choose the best format for your campaign objective and target audience. •
Bidding Strategies: Choosing the right bidding strategy, such as cost-per-click (CPC), cost-per-thousand impressions (CPM), and cost-per-conversion (CPC), can help you optimize your ad spend and achieve your campaign objective. •
Ad Performance Analysis: Analyzing ad performance, including metrics such as click-through rate (CTR), conversion rate, and cost per conversion, can help you identify areas for improvement and optimize your campaign. •
A/B Testing: Conducting A/B testing, including testing different ad creative, targeting options, and bidding strategies, can help you determine which elements drive the best results and optimize your campaign for better performance. •
Ad Campaign Management Tools: Utilizing ad campaign management tools, such as LinkedIn Ads Manager and Google Ads, can help you streamline your ad management process, optimize your campaigns, and achieve better ROI.
